WD updates WD TV media player with Miracast
May 27, 2014 – WD (NASDAQ: WDC) has unveiled the new WD TV – Personal Edition, an easy to use Wi-Fi enabled media player that plays virtually any media file stored on USB and network storage devices or any computer on the home network.

WD TV™ HD Media Player brings digital media collections to the big screen
Nov 3, 2008 – WD® (NYSE: WDC) has introduced the WD TV™ Media Player which connects to a user's TV or home theater and plays digital movies, music and photos from WD's My Passport™ portable drive or other USB mass storage device.

WD® Delivers Hundreds More Hours to High Definition Tivo® DVRs
Oct 23, 2007 – Expanding consumers' TV recording capabilities by as many as hundreds of hours, WD® (NYSE: WDC) has announced that its My DVR Expander™ external hard drives are verified compatible with TiVo® HD and TiVo Series3™ DVRs (digital video recorders).
